Material Specifications
1.Frame Material Standards
Aluminum alloys must conform to EN 755 extrusion standards
Thermal break materials require minimum 24MPa shear strength
Steel components meet ASTM A653 galvanized steel specifications
2.Glazing Requirements
Tempered glass compliance with ANSI Z97.1 impact standards
Laminated glass interlayer thickness minimum 0.76mm
Insulating glass unit desiccant capacity for 30-year service life
3.Hardware Components
Hinges tested to 200,000 cycle durability standard
Lock mechanisms meeting ANSI/BHMA grade 1 security requirements
Weatherstripping materials with 15-year minimum lifespan
Performance Testing Protocols
1.Structural Integrity Testing
Uniform load deflection testing per ASTM E330
Ultimate strength testing to 1.5 times design load
Repeated operating force measurement per EN 13115
2.Environmental Resistance
Water penetration testing at 15% above design pressure
Air infiltration testing per ASTM E283 standards
Thermal cycling tests with 100 temperature cycles
3.Operational Testing
Mechanical durability testing of 10,000 operating cycles
Forced entry resistance testing per EN 1627 standards
Impact resistance testing for safety glazing compliance
Manufacturing Quality Control
1.Dimensional Tolerances
Frame straightness within ±1mm per linear meter
Opening dimensions within ±1.5mm of specified measurements
Hardware alignment within ±0.5mm tolerance
2.Assembly Standards
Corner joint strength testing to 1,500N/m
Glazing bite compliance with ASTM C1249 minimums
Sealant application per manufacturer specifications
3.Surface Treatment
Anodic oxidation coating minimum 15μm thickness
Powder coating adhesion per ASTM D3359
Color consistency testing with ΔE<1.0 variation
Installation Requirements
1.Structural Interface
Anchor spacing maximum 600mm for standard applications
Shim material compression resistance minimum 20MPa
Expansion joint sizing per ASTM E2112
2.Weatherproofing
Flashing integration per ASTM E331 requirements
Perimeter sealant joint design for 25% movement capacity
Weep hole placement at 400mm maximum spacing
3.Performance Verification
Post-installation water testing at design pressure
Operational force measurement verification
Final alignment inspection per project specifications
